Key Components on the Diagram

While specific layouts vary between models and transmission types, a typical diagram will highlight:

  • Torque Converter: The fluid coupling that transfers power from the engine to the transmission.
  • Valve Body: The “brain” of an automatic transmission, directing fluid pressure to engage clutches and bands.
  • Gear Sets (Planetary Gears): The intricate arrangement of gears that provides different ratios.
  • Clutches and Bands: Components that engage and disengage to select gears.
  • Sensors: Input/output speed sensors, temperature sensors, etc., which feed data to the transmission control module (TCM).
  • Solenoids: Electrically controlled valves that manage fluid flow in the valve body.
  • Fluid Pump: Circulates transmission fluid throughout the system.

Each component plays a critical role, and understanding their placement and function on the diagram helps you connect symptoms to potential causes.

Decoding Common Honda Accord Transmission Types

Honda Accords have sported several different transmission types over the years. Knowing which one your vehicle has is crucial when consulting a honda accord transmission diagram, as each type has a distinct internal structure and common failure points.

Automatic Transmissions (AT)

Many older and some newer Accords feature conventional automatic transmissions. These often have 4-speed, 5-speed, or 6-speed configurations. On a diagram, you’ll see a clear layout of planetary gear sets, multiple clutch packs, and a complex valve body system that uses hydraulic pressure to shift gears. Diagnosing issues like harsh shifts or delayed engagement often involves checking solenoid operation and fluid pressure pathways shown on the diagram.

Continuously Variable Transmissions (CVT)

Modern Honda Accords, especially from the 9th generation onwards, frequently use CVTs. These transmissions operate differently, using two pulleys and a steel belt to provide an infinite range of gear ratios. A CVT diagram will show the drive and driven pulleys, the steel belt, and a sophisticated hydraulic control system that varies the pulley diameters. Common problems with these transmissions can include shuddering or whining, which might point to belt or pulley wear, or issues with the CVT fluid pump and control solenoids, all visible on the diagram.

Manual Transmissions (MT)

While less common in recent years, many older Accords, particularly enthusiast models, came with manual transmissions. A manual transmission diagram will illustrate the input shaft, countershaft, output shaft, synchronizers, and selector forks. Problems like grinding gears or difficulty shifting can often be traced to worn synchronizers or clutch issues, which a diagram helps you visualize in relation to the gear engagement mechanisms.

Common Problems & Troubleshooting with Your Honda Accord Transmission Diagram

Even the most reliable Honda Accord can develop transmission issues. Knowing your honda accord transmission diagram becomes invaluable when diagnosing these common problems. It helps you visualize the internal mechanisms that could be failing, guiding your troubleshooting steps.

Slipping Gears

If your engine revs but the car doesn’t accelerate as it should, or if it feels like the transmission is “missing” a gear, you might be experiencing slipping. On an automatic transmission diagram, this often points to issues with clutch packs, bands, or low fluid pressure due to a failing pump or valve body solenoid. For CVTs, it could indicate a worn belt or pulley system, which you can locate on the diagram.

Harsh Shifting

Sudden jerks or clunks when shifting gears can be uncomfortable and concerning. This symptom often relates to the valve body, solenoids, or the transmission control module (TCM). Consulting the diagram allows you to identify the specific solenoids responsible for gear engagement and fluid pressure regulation, helping you check for electrical issues or blockages in fluid passages. This is a common area for common problems with honda accord transmission diagram investigation.

Fluid Leaks

Puddles under your car are never a good sign. Transmission fluid leaks can originate from various points: the pan gasket, axle seals, cooler lines, or the torque converter seal. Your diagram shows the exact routing of these fluid lines and the location of seals, making it easier to trace the source of the leak and determine the necessary repair, such as replacing a gasket or a cracked cooler line.

Warning Lights & Error Codes

The “Check Engine” or “D4” light (on older models) can illuminate for transmission-related issues. Using an OBD-II scanner will often provide a diagnostic trouble code (DTC). These codes frequently point to specific sensors (e.g., input/output speed sensors) or solenoids. With your honda accord transmission diagram, you can quickly locate the component referenced by the code, allowing for targeted testing or replacement.

Fluid Checks & Changes

Transmission fluid is the lifeblood of your gearbox. It lubricates, cools, and transmits hydraulic pressure. Check your fluid regularly, especially if you tow or drive in extreme conditions. Consult your diagram to locate the transmission dipstick (for ATs) or fill/drain plugs (for CVTs and MTs). Always use the Honda-specific fluid recommended for your Accord’s year and transmission type – for example, Honda DW-1 for automatics or Honda HCF-2 for CVTs. Changing fluid at recommended intervals (often 30,000-60,000 miles, depending on usage and type) is crucial.

  • Check level: Engine warm, on a level surface, often with the engine running (check your manual).
  • Inspect condition: Fluid should be clear red/pink, not dark brown or black, and free of burnt smells or metallic particles.
  • Drain and fill: Follow your service manual precisely for drain and fill procedures. This often involves multiple drain-and-fill cycles for a more complete fluid exchange.

Filter Replacement

Many automatic transmissions have internal or external filters that catch debris. While some internal filters are “lifetime” and only replaced during a rebuild, others are serviceable. Your honda accord transmission diagram will show the location of these filters. Replacing external filters (if applicable to your model) during a fluid change is an excellent way to maintain clean fluid flow and protect internal components. Safety First!

Working on a transmission involves heavy components, hot fluids, and moving parts. Always prioritize safety:

  • Disconnect the battery: Before working on any electrical components or removing sensors.
  • Use jack stands: Never rely solely on a jack. Secure your vehicle with sturdy jack stands on a level surface.
  • Wear PPE: Gloves, safety glasses, and appropriate work clothing are essential.
  • Allow to cool: Transmission fluid can be extremely hot. Let the vehicle cool down before draining fluid.
  • Clean up spills: Transmission fluid is slippery. Clean up any spills immediately to prevent falls.

Frequently Asked Questions About Your Honda Accord Transmission

What is the most common transmission problem in Honda Accords?

For older automatic Accords, harsh shifting, slipping, and delayed engagement due to worn clutch packs or valve body issues are common. For CVTs in newer Accords, shuddering, whining, or loss of power often point to belt/pulley wear or fluid degradation. Regular fluid changes are key to preventing many of these.

Can I use any transmission fluid in my Honda Accord?

Absolutely not! Honda transmissions are very particular about fluid type. Using the wrong fluid (e.g., generic multi-vehicle fluid instead of Honda DW-1 for ATs or Honda HCF-2 for CVTs) can cause severe damage, premature wear, and void warranties. Always refer to your owner’s manual for the correct specification.

How often should I check my transmission fluid?

It’s a good practice to check your transmission fluid every oil change (typically every 5,000-7,500 miles) or at least every 15,000 miles. Look for proper level, color, and smell. Early detection of low or degraded fluid can prevent major problems.

What does a “transmission limp mode” mean?

If your Accord goes into “limp mode,” the transmission control module (TCM) has detected a serious fault. To prevent further damage, it restricts the transmission to a single gear (often 2nd or 3rd) and limits engine power. This is a critical warning sign that requires immediate diagnosis, often with an OBD-II scanner, and consulting your honda accord transmission diagram to identify the faulty component.

Is it worth rebuilding a Honda Accord transmission?

The decision to rebuild or replace depends on several factors: the extent of the damage, the cost difference, and the overall condition of the vehicle. A rebuild can be cost-effective if only specific components are worn, but a full replacement (new or remanufactured) might be better for extensive damage or very high mileage. Always get quotes for both options from reputable shops.
